WebbThe Solar System is littered with small objects made of rock and ice. These are the comets and minor planets — asteroids, Kuiper Belt objects, and other tiny fragments left over from the time when the Solar System was first born. WebbTimeline of known close approaches less than one lunar distance from Earth. A list of known near-Earth asteroid close approaches less than 1 lunar distance (0.0025696 AU (384,410 km; 238,860 mi)) from Earth in 2024. As most asteroids passing within a lunar distance are less than 40 meters in diameter, they generally are not detected until they …
